

"Papa" John Robert Ferguson Jr. died of natural causes in the evening hours on Monday, June 8, 2015 at the age of 93. He was born on March 23, 1922 in Aberdeen, South Dakota. He served honorably in the United States Navy from 1942-1945, during which he met the love of his life in Memphis, Tennessee.
He is survived by his wife of 70 years, Edith Ferguson; children, Gary and Coleen Ferguson, Vicki and Roy Deskin, Nancy and Eric Swanson, and Robert Ferguson and Kathia Wile; grandchildren, Chris and Paige Deskin, Emily and Josh Lukins, Jenny and Robert Nathanson, Travis Swanson and Liz Rinehart, JC Ferguson and Erin Patterson, Thomas Ferguson, Trent Rees, and Greg and Kimberly Rees; ever-loved great-grandchildren, Pearl, Maggie, and Tate Deskin, Georgia Ferguson, Clara Nathanson, Jaz Welch, and Dylan Rees.
He retired as an insurance agent and was a founding partner of Faded Blue Jeans Ministry, working tirelessly to assist inmates in finding faith and direction. He also loved woodworking and had boundless enthusiasm for the latest investment breakthrough. At most family gatherings, he would express amazement at the general success and wellbeing of his children, grandchildren, and great-grandchildren. He would express equal amazement when reminded of his role in our combined happiness. John was a member of University Presbyterian Church since 1959, where he served as a ruling Elder and a Sunday school teacher for many of those years. He remained dedicated to his faith and adamant that his life's success was by the grace of the Lord, our God.
